Output 596e672b6a03fb3c4586531aa7666c5875ed7a21e2657ec37e77d5048ebe7f64:12

value
34275738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fe54f9dcc8da65e230e04e1e679cfbc94a8b0e OP_EQUAL
address
MPJiRx5onrfM4apA6g8nSJoTEfSrLuor3q
transaction
596e672b6a03fb3c4586531aa7666c5875ed7a21e2657ec37e77d5048ebe7f64
spent
true